On the slightly darker side, there is Breezeblocks by Alt-J. I would say that this song falls into the suprisingly addictive category. I purchased this on a whim but then found myself putting it onto repeat, singing alton to all of the words, and trying to match the unusual, almost monotone, voice of Joe Newman(the lead singer). Only when one truly listens to, and dissects the lyrics is the true, murderous, and heartbreaking meaning behind the song revealed. Nonetheless, this is a fantastic song which will only become more popular in the months to come.
